So I recently replaced my T Stat with some parts from autozone, From what I've read the foam gasket I bought it junk. Anyway after doing the install and replacement I drove the car about 4 miles and then parked it in my garage with no leak. The next morning I came out and there was a lake of coolant on the floor. I figured that it had been the hose that runs off the back of the T Stat housing in a U shape towards the drivers side. Replaced it with some hose I got at Napa (Not oem, just a hose I cut to fit) and that didnt solve the problem. Then last night I was looking around for the leak after adding some coolant and it looks like it coming from a area with two clamps towards the bottom of the engine.
